Bryr is unloading its back-clog (pun most certainly intended) of shoes on Saturday, November 10 with a massive sample sale in the Dogpatch. The sale starts at 11 am and ends at 4 pm.

The local clog-maker will be offering styles at 20–70 percent discounts for one day only at a new location, 2455 3rd Street. (That's just down the street from the regular Bryr studio.) And, taking a cue from the recent Baggu and Freda Salvador sales, the shoemaker has plenty of surprises up its sleeve. Those include way more clogs than last year, a lounge by Shelter Co, music from Heart of Gold, a specially-designed tote bag from Baggu, and more. This year, they’re also hosting a shop-within-a-shop for those who want to order made-to-order clogs.

Pricing for the sale varies according to the item class. Perfect clogs from inventory will be 20 percent off, shop samples are 30 percent off, seconds and older samples are 40 percent off, and irregular samples are 60 percent off. You can also score gently-worn clogs for 70 percent off. All proceeds from the worn clog sales will go to Safehouse, a local healing space for women that addresses gender-specific trauma, homelessness and substance abuse. (You can donate gently used BRYR clogs—and get $20 in Bryr-cash—by dropping them off at the studio, 2331 3rd Street, before November 9.)
